Web1 jul. 2010 · The company’s fundamental perspective was that gas prices in the next two years would stay within a range of $5.00 to $8.00 per million BTUs. By hedging production at $5.50 per million BTUs, the company protected itself from only a $0.50 decline in prices and gave up a potential upside of $2.50 if prices rose to $8.00. WebIn a hedge fund, and usually the implication is that a hedge fund will be more actively managed, they'll get a larger management fees. So larger management fee, instead of the 1%, 1% is actually a lot for mutual fund. Instead of that, hedge funds tend to be 1% to 2%. So 1% to 2% management fee, and sometimes even larger than that. Web10 apr. 2024 · The idea of hedge funds consists in collecting money and then investing it as a pooled resource to earn returns. When profits come in, they are divided amongst the investors according to the percentages of their investments minus the amount they have agreed to pay to the fund manager for the services offered.

The world’s biggest hedge fund by a mile is Ray Dalio’s Bridgewater Associates. At the time of this ranking, Bridgewater managed over $126 billion in assets for clients as wide ranging as university endowment funds, charities, and foreign country’s central banks.
